Web29 Dec 2024 · There are two main components to events: event handlers, and event listeners. When you click a button, press a key, or hover over an element, an event is run. The event handler is the code that runs when your event starts. For example, when you click a button, the event handler will run. Also, the code defines what to do when that event occurs: Example What is the time Try it Live Learn on Udacity Usually, the code to be executed on the event is … Web27 Jul 2024 · JavaScript provides an event handler in the form of the addEventListener () method. This handler can be attached to a specific HTML element you wish to monitor events for, and the element can have more than one handler attached. addEventListener () Syntax Here's the syntax: target.addEventListener (event, function, useCapture)
